Using Benchmarks/Metrics to evaluate performance

• Profitability by product, customer, process

• Sales by employee

• Process cost by employee

• Production hours by product

• Benchmarks are a way to measure how well the business is doing.  Defining benchmarks is critical to measuring the success of your business.

• Macro benchmarks such as profitability and output look at the overall business

• Micro benchmarks target specific processes, customers, or products

• Leading or lagging indicators may drive business decisions in your industry such as new construction, interest rates or the labor market

• Setting up metrics to measure whether you are achieving those goals is critical to identify where your efforts should be to get your business back on track.
